With its intense ruby red color, this wine stands out with a particularly broad and nuanced bouquet. Aromas of blackberries, ripe blueberries, and small red fruits are complemented by fresh citrus notes, while subtle hints of dark spices and medicinal herbs add complexity. The wine finishes long, with a firm tannic structure that offers both depth and balance. Dynamic and flavorful, it features a lively acidity that integrates seamlessly with the tannins, resulting in a wine of great elegance and character. - TA
